Q: Is 77,205,027 a Prime Number?
A: No, 77,205,027 is not a prime number.
A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.
The number 77205027 can be evenly divided by 1 3 109 179 327 537 1,319 3,957 19,511 58,533 143,771 236,101 431,313 708,303 25,735,009 and 77,205,027, with no remainder.
Since 77,205,027 cannot be divided by just 1 and 77,205,027, it is not a prime number.
